While I can agree that it helps to see the trend better, I would argue that the rate of change, that is, how fast a trend is moving in the unit of time, could be an indicator of exhaustion or reversal for that trend.
Maybe you can give some examples how it helps you?

Time based bars form a uniform amount of bars per time interval on a time axis. Price based bars do not. If it takes a nanosecond or the whole eternity to form a preset fixed amount Of movement per bar then that is what it is.
